Sarah

The big advice we had for Sarah that you can't see in this photo is about her nail polish. It was all chipped off!  When your nail polish starts coming off, just remove all of it. Chipped off polish makes your nails and fingers look shorter and your whole appearance a little sloppier.

Gene

Gene was one of my first "customers" on Friday.  He wanted some tips on how to dress casually and what you can and can't wear with polo shirts and cargo shorts.

Polo shirts are generally a casual look, but can be worn with almost any pants. A khaki pant with a belt and the shirt tucked in will give you a more presentable look.  For cargo shorts, I think you can wear pretty much any casual top (while its trendy right now for girls to wearbaggy jeans with blazers, this is not a good look for guys.) If you are wearing something tailored on top, like a blazer, wear something that fits just as well on the bottom. This can be jeans, as long as they fit well and aren't too destroyed looking.
